About ZIP Code 72432

ZIP code 72432 is located in Harrisburg, Arkansas, within Poinsett County. With a population of 6,537, this is a lightly populated ZIP code with a relatively young community — the median age is 36.8 years. Economically, 72432 is a solidly middle-class ZIP code: the median household income of $57,687 is below the national average.

Real estate in ZIP code 72432 represents one of the more affordable housing markets in the country. The median home value of $112,700 is well below the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$811 per month in median rent. Homeownership is strong here — 70.4% of occupied units are owner-occupied, suggesting an established, stable residential community. Median home values have increased by 34% since 2019.

The population of 72432 is primarily White (90.91%). Residents are less-educated — 15.2%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is well below the national average. Poverty affects some residents at 18.6%. Household income has grown by 30% since 2019.
